Preventing and tackling the phenomenon of child abuse was the theme of the online conference organized by KMOP – Social Action and Innovation Center, as part of the European Erasmus+ project “Co-Happiness: Happy and safe in the Community“. The aim was to inform and raise public awareness in order to prevent cases of child abuse […]

Promoting successful practices for the integration of migrants in local communities

Prejudices and stereotypes that prevail in Greek society in relation to migrants and how these can be overcome, as well as stories of successful integration of migrants, were some of the main discussion topics of the Greek Diversity Dialogue Forum.
